Demarcus Cousins Continues Stellar Play but Kings Continue to Struggle

blog:16106:0::0
By Iman Sadri
Posted Apr 11, 2012 in Sports
Some losing streaks do have a bright side. The Sacramento Kings have lost the past five games but Demarcus Cousins is in a hot streak. In that stretch, Cousins is averaging 19.6 points and 12.2 rebounds. The last five losses have come at the hands of a Texas (backwards) two step, losing to Houston and Dallas. The Kings earlier dropped two back to back contests to the Clippers, and suffered a home defeat at the hands of the Steve Nash led Phoenix Suns. Cousins, however, has mostly outplayed his opponent, especially where he shined against Marcin Gortat of the Suns with a 41 point outburst.
His maturity and patience are coming along, as is his encouragement of his teammates. He is developing a keen altruistic ability to involve and commend his teammates when make a productive play. He still needs to develop quickness to hustle down the floor to defend the transition. However, his court awareness and coordination are unparalleled for his 6-11 frame. The Kings are lacking a defensive identity and as Cousins develops so will the Kings's abilities to slow their opponents fast break opportunities.
The Kings have lost two out of their last ten. But they may make a run to close out the month, thanks in large part to the productivity of Cousins.
